Heads up coastal property owners. We left Lanark at 1:00 pm today in a steady, no kidding, 30 to 35 knot east wind and driving rain. The water had already covered many of the HW-98 docks and that was at low tide. It may be a nice little rain in town but it's gettin serious down at the coast.

Lanark has lost over a dozen docks and were supposed to get another 2-5 feet tonight. I will end up losing my bar and patio wall over night. Its been blowin a good 30-40 most of the day. :thumbdown:
